Tracks – Panther1944
Product Details: Tracks for the Panzerkampfwagen Panther, also used in Jagdpanther, known as ‘Trockenbolzen-Scharnierkette’ (dry single-pin track).
Technical Parameters:
– Track links per side: 86
– Track width: 660 mm
– Track pitch: 150 mm
– Track weight: 2050 kg
– Ground pressure: 0.88 kp/cm² (Ausf. D and A), 0.89 kp/cm² (Ausf. G and F)
Application Scenarios:
– Used in armored vehicles like the Panther and Jagdpanther.
– Can be equipped with ice sprags for icy road conditions.
Pros:
– Enhanced grip with late version tracks featuring six cheveroned cleats.
– Durable material (Niresit) suitable for high-temperature applications.
Cons:
– Weight of complete chain is significant (2050 kg).
– Niresit material may not have non-rusting properties.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
What types of tank tracks are produced in factories?
Tank track factories typically produce various types of tracks, including rubber tracks, steel tracks, and composite tracks. Each type is designed for specific applications, such as military tanks, construction vehicles, or agricultural machinery. The choice of material affects durability, weight, and traction, ensuring optimal performance for different environments.
How are tank tracks manufactured?
The manufacturing process involves several steps, including material selection, molding or forging, heat treatment, and quality control. Advanced machinery and technology are used to ensure precision and durability. Each track is rigorously tested to meet safety and performance standards before it leaves the factory.
What is the lifespan of tank tracks?
The lifespan of tank tracks can vary significantly based on the type, usage, and maintenance. Generally, rubber tracks last around 1,500 to 3,000 hours of operation, while steel tracks can last much longer, often exceeding 5,000 hours. Regular inspections and proper maintenance can extend their lifespan.
Can tank tracks be repaired or refurbished?
Yes, tank tracks can often be repaired or refurbished to extend their usability. This may involve replacing worn components, re-tensioning, or reconditioning the surface. Refurbishing can be a cost-effective solution, allowing you to maximize the lifespan of your tracks while maintaining performance.
